Test Research on HIMS-Reverse Flotation of Oolitic Hematite of Longyan Iron Mine, Xuan Steel

Abstract: In order to better exploit and utilize the oolitic hematite ore resource in Zhangjiakou region, staged grinding-separation process consisting of high intensity magnetic separation (HIMS) and reverse floatation was adopted in the beneficiation test on the regionally representative oolitic hematite ore of Longyan Iron Mine, Xuan Steel.The test results indicate that, with Slong pulsating high gradient magnetic separation as HIMS equipment, with NaOH, starch, CaO and TS as flotation reagents, and at a grind of 65% -200 mesh for the primary grinding and 95%-200 mesh for the secondary grinding, an iron concentrate grading 62.34% and having an iron recovery of 53.07% can be achieved after two stage HIMS and one roughing-one cleaning reverse flotation.
